The city Beppu is one of Japan's most famous hot spring resorts, producing more hot spring water than any other city in the country. It is the right place for relaxing, calming for mind and soul.

You should go in one of the famous Onsen here. Just inform yourself before, where tattoos are prohibited.

Photography Tips

Wait until the night sets in. The upcoming fog from the hot springs in combination with the city lights looks amazing. Bring your tripod for a longtime exposure with you, switch to the manual focus mode and choose your shutter between 10-20 sec. That's more than enough here for the effect of a longtime exposure.

Travel Information

For Kyushu it is worth it to rent a car. You are way much more flexible than with the trains.

The parking lot from the observation deck is directly in front of the building.
